Official title

The Clinical Application of Tumor Reversion: A Phase I Study of Sertraline (Zoloft) in Combination With Timed-sequential Cytosine Arabinoside (Ara-C) in Adults With Relapsed and Refractory Acute Myeloid Leukemia (AML)
